Phi Beta Kappa Dinner

NO WRITER ATTRIBUTED

Judge William Cushing Wait '82, president, will act as toastmaster at the annual winter meeting of the Harvard Chapter of Phi Beta Kappa for the reception of new members at a dinner to be given in the Faculty Room. Harvard Union, at 6.30 o'clock tomorrow night.

There will be several speakers among them President Lowell. Members of other chapters are invited to be present and are requested to notify Professor W. G. Howard '91, secretary of the Harvard chapter, at 91 Garden Street, Cambridge. Tickets are $2.50 each.
